ポイントからラインへ最短距離のラインを引く方法

585 views
Skip to first unread message

nakabayashi

unread,
Sep 12, 2019, 2:56:58 AM9/12/19
to QGIS初心者質問グループ
初めまして。
初歩的な質問になってしまうのですが、ご教授いただければと思います。

下記のような状態で、
住戸(ポリゴン)の重心(ポイント)から、道路中心線(青色ライン)までの最短距離のラインを引きたいと思っています。
それぞれ別レイヤーです。
何か方法があれば教えていただきたいです。よろしくお願いいたします。

スクリーンショット 2019-09-12 15.55.18.png


キタ

unread,
Sep 12, 2019, 10:59:01 AM9/12/19
to QGIS初心者質問グループ
まず準備として、道路のラインを細かく切断します。
プロセッシングツールの「最大長で線を切断」をします。できるだけ細かいほうが、正確な距離が出せると思いますが、まずは試しに1mで切断してみましょう。これで準備は終わりです。

ポイントから一番近い道路にラインを引きます。
プロセッシングツールの「最寄りのハブの距離(ハブへの線)」を実行します。このコマンドは、ポイントから一番近いラインの中心位置に線を引きます。道路ラインが長いままだと、長い線の中心に線を結んでしまうので、準備で道路ラインを短く切断しました。
入力レイヤをポイントに、ハブレイヤを切断した道路ラインにします。
引き継ぎたい属性があれば選択して、計測単位は「メートル」でいいと思います。
実行すると、線が作図されます。

キタ

諒中林

unread,
Sep 16, 2019, 9:27:19 AM9/16/19
to QGIS初心者質問グループ
キタ様

返信が遅くなり申し訳ありません。
上記の方法で行ったところ、求めていた結果を出すことができました。
素早い回答ありがとうございました。
また何かあったときは何卒宜しくお願い致します。

Reply all
Reply to author
Forward
0 new messages